2026-06-01 19:23:28T & I Global Ltd's latest financial results for Q4 FY26 reveal a complex situation characterized by significant revenue growth alongside substantial profitability challenges. The company reported a net profit of ₹0.05 crores, which reflects a notable decline of 87.18% year-on-year, indicating difficulties in converting increased sales into profits. In contrast, revenue surged to ₹41.72 crores, marking a year-on-year growth of 55.67%, and a quarter-on-quarter increase of 66.81%, suggesting strong sales momentum. However, the operational performance raises concerns. The operating margin (excluding other income) fell to -8.27%, although this represents an improvement from the previous year's -18.92%. The gross profit margin also declined sharply to 1.68% from 13.83% in the prior quarter, highlighting potential issues with pricing power or rising input costs. T & I Global Q4 FY26: Razor-Thin Profit Masks Deeper Operational Concerns
2026-06-01 12:45:28T & I Global Ltd., a Kolkata-based manufacturer and exporter of tea processing machinery, reported a concerning fourth quarter for FY26, with net profit collapsing 87.18% year-on-year to just ₹0.05 crores from ₹0.39 crores in Q4 FY25. Despite a robust 55.67% surge in quarterly revenue to ₹41.72 crores, the company's profitability has evaporated, raising serious questions about operational efficiency and cost management. The stock, currently trading at ₹176.25 with a market capitalisation of ₹80 crores, has responded positively with an 8.10% gain in the latest trading session, though this appears disconnected from the fundamental deterioration visible in the numbers.
